Responsibilities
Conduct comprehensive evaluations of the patient’s speech, language, cognitive‑communication, and swallowing abilities.
Develop and implement individualized treatment plans to address patients’ specific needs and communication goals.
Provide therapy for speech, language, voice, fluency, and swallowing disorders using evidence‑based practices.
Educate patients and families on communication strategies, speech exercises, and safe swallowing techniques.
Document patient progress and communicate effectively with referring physicians and other healthcare professionals.
Collaborate with the rehabilitation team to ensure coordinated and effective care.
Qualifications
Graduate of an accredited Speech Language Pathology program.
Current state licensure as a Speech Language Pathologist.
Valid driver’s license and reliable transportation.
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
Strong organizational and time‑management skills.
Ability to work independently and as part of a team.
Compassionate and patient‑centered approach.
